Why? Their built into the slide comp is not a comp at all. There are no chambers of any kind, almost no baffles for gasses to react on. They are simply free openings out the top of the slide where some gasses will go simply following the path of least resistance. My wife has the P365XL Rose, which has their Spectre comp built into it. In my observation, it does nothing. I borrowed an actual p365XL barrel that extends through the 'comp' section to the end of the slide, bypassing the entire thing and it felt identical to me. Thinking about buying an XL barrel and having a couple small hybrid barrel ports cut in it just underneath the 'comp' opening. Now that will have a noticeable effect. The point is that you don't need it. P365 models just shoot that good because they are that good...except for the trigger, anyway. The trigger on my wife's limited edition P365 XL Rose is long, gritty, not smooth at all. I cannot even determine a defined wall, so I don't know when I'm at the break, when it will fire. That is what would keep me from being interested in the Fuse. I'm not a fan of my P320 X5 Max trigger either, but it's much better than the P365. If you don't mind or like the P365 trigger, the Fuse is probably awesome just as it is.
